How to convert degrees per second to hertz
To convert degrees per second to hertz, divide a degrees per second value by 360.
Formula Hz = °/s ÷ 360
Example: Convert 3600 degrees per second to hertz Calculations: 3600 °/s ÷ 360 = 10 Hz
Degree per second (°/s)
The degree per second is a unit of angular frequency, defined as the angle (in degrees) an object rotates through per second around a fixed axis. It is equal to 1/360 of a hertz, or 1/6 of a revolution per minute.
Hertz (Hz)
The hertz is a unit of frequency, defined as one cycle per second. One hertz is equal to 2π radians per second, or 60 revolutions per minute.
